Line Item 0001 CCATT BAGS, measures 27" h. x 22" w. x 12" d. and offers 7128 cu. in. of storage. Constructed of 1000d Cordura, the pack features: " Two full-length side pockets (27"h x 9"w x 6"d, 1458 cu. in.) with dual zipper access " A full-length rear pocket (27"h x 16"w x 4"d, 1728 cu. in.) with dual zipper access across the top " Heavy-duty, ergonomically designed, padded backpack straps with quick-release sternum and waist straps " Center access via dual zippers to the main compartment, which opens to reveal a roll-out module with one row of various sized, gusseted Cordura pockets and five rows of various sized mesh pockets (all have flaps with Velcro closure); pockets are numbered for easy inventory control; three straps are stitched into the top edge of the Roll Pack to enable hanging from a fixed location " Two additional Cordura pockets and two additional mesh pockets with center zipper access are affixed to the right and left interior walls of the Back Pack " An extra, removable Cordura backed, mesh front pouch measures 27"l x 8"h x 3"d " Color black Width (Side Pocket to Side Pocket) = 22 inches Depth (Front Pocket to Back of Pack) = 12 inches Length (Top to Bottom) = 27 inches Side Pocket Dimensions = 27"L x 9"W x 6" D Front Pocket Dimensions = 27"L x 16" W x 4"D Roll Pack (Quantity of 2) = 33"L x 27"W x 3"D Extra (Removable) Pouch = 8"L x 27"W x 3"D MFR: IRON DUCK -MFR P/N: 44455 - QTY - 256 EA. - UNIT PRICE _________________, TOTAL_________________. The following additional provisions and clauses apply: 52.212-2, Evaluation-Commercial Item, the Government will award a contract resulting from this solicitation to the responsible offerors whose offer conforming to the solicitation will be most advantageous to the government, price and other factors considered. The following factors shall be used to evaluate offers: 1) Technically acceptable; 2) Past Performance; and 3) Price. Technically acceptable is more important than past performance and price. Technically acceptable will be evaluated based on the function and operation of the item. To be technically acceptable the item shall meet the Government's specifications. Offerors shall submit descriptive literature, product samples, technical features, and warranty provisions. Past performance is considered more important than price. Past performance will be evaluated to ensure satisfactory business practices and timely performance. Price will be considered as the least important factor. Price will be evaluated to determine its fairness, completeness, and reasonableness as it relates to the items offered. 52.212-3, Offeror Representations and Certifications-Commercial Items, a completed copy of this provision shall be submitted with the offer. 52.212-4, Contract Terms and Conditions-Commercial Items. 52.212-5, Contract Terms and Conditions Required to Implement Statutes or Executive Orders-Commercial Items, to include clauses: 5,14,15,16,17,18,19, 20, 23, 24, 31, and 32.
